Southern Oregon Head Start is a nonprofit-focused program in the field of individual and family services that supports early childhood development for children from birth to five years old and aims to strengthen family well-being. Based in Central Point, Oregon, the organization operates through early education initiatives that prepare children for school and lifelong learning by fostering healthy development and nurturing parental relationships. Its work is anchored in the Head Start and Early Head Start frameworks, with a mission to help children enter school healthy, ready to learn, and with age-appropriate skills, while also addressing family needs and promoting ongoing learning for both children and parents.
